Abstract

Antigen-binding constructs, e.g., antibodies, which bind CD3 and CD 19 and methods of use are disclosed.

Claims (202)

1 . An antigen-binding construct comprising

a first antigen-binding polypeptide construct comprising a first scFv comprising a first VL, a first scFv linker, and a first VH, the first scFv monovalently and specifically binding a CD19 antigen, the first scFv selected from the group consisting of an anti-CD19 antibody HD37 scFv, a modified HD37 scFv, an HD37 blocking antibody scFv, and a modified HD37 blocking antibody scFv, wherein the HD37 blocking antibody blocks by 50% or greater the binding of HD37 to the CD19 antigen;

a second antigen-binding polypeptide construct comprising a second scFv comprising a second VL, a second scFv linker, and a second VH, the second scFv monovalently and specifically binding an epsilon subunit of a CD3 antigen, the second scFv selected from the group consisting of the OKT3 scFv, a modified OKT3 scFv, an OKT3 blocking antibody scFv, and a modified OKT3 blocking antibody scFv, wherein the OKT3 blocking antibody blocks by 50% or greater the binding of OKT3 to the epsilon subunit of the CD3 antigen;

a heterodimeric Fc comprising first and second Fc polypeptides each comprising a modified CH3 sequence capable of forming a dimerized CH3 domain, wherein each modified CH3 sequence comprises asymmetric amino acid modifications that promote formation of a heterodimeric Fc and the dimerized CH3 domains have a melting temperature (Tm) of about 68° C. or higher, and wherein the first Fc polypeptide is linked to the first antigen-binding polypeptide construct with a first hinge linker, and the second Fc polypeptide is linked to the second antigen-binding polypeptide construct with a second hinge linker.

22 . The antigen-binding construct of claim 20 or 21 , the heterodimeric Fc comprising at least one CH2 domain comprising one or more amino acid substitutions that reduce the ability of the heterodimeric Fc to bind to FcγRs or complement.

23 . The antigen-binding construct of any one of claims 1 to 22 , wherein the binding affinity of the first scFv for CD19 is between about 0.1 nM to about 5 nM, and the binding affinity of the second scFv for the epsilon subunit of CD3 is between about 1 nM to about 100 nM.

24 . The antigen-binding construct of any one of claims 1 to 23 , wherein the heterodimeric Fc

a. is a human Fc; and/or

b. is a human IgG1 Fc; and/or

c. comprises one or more modifications in at least one of the CH3 domains as described in Table A; and/or

d. further comprises at least one CH2 domain; and/or

e. further comprises at least one CH2 domain comprising one or more modifications; and/or

f. further comprises at least one CH2 domain comprising one or more modifications in at least one of the CH2 domains as described in Table B; and/or

g. further comprises at least one CH2 domain comprising one or more amino acid substitutions that reduce the ability of the heterodimeric Fc to bind to FcγRs or complement as described in Table C; and/or

h. further comprises at least one CH2 domain comprising amino acid substitutions N297A or L234A_L235A, or L234A_L235A_D265S.

25 . The antigen-binding construct of any one of claims 1 to 24 ; wherein the dimerized CH3 domains have a melting temperature (Tm) of 68, 69, 70, 71, 72, 73, 74, 75, 76, 77, 77.5, 78, 79, 80, 81, 82, 83, 84, or 85° C. or higher.

26 . The antigen-binding construct of any one of claims 1 to 25 , wherein the antigen-binding construct

a) is capable of synapse formation and bridging between CD19+ Raji B-cells and Jurkat T-cells as assayed by FACS and/or microscopy; and/or

b) mediates T-cell directed killing of CD19-expressing B cells in human whole blood or PBMCs; and/or

c) displays improved biophysical properties compared to v875 or v1661; and/or

d) displays improved protein expression and yield compared to v875 or v1661, e.g., expressed at >4-10 mg/L after SEC (size exclusion chromatography) when expressed and purified under similar conditions; and/or

e) displays heterodimer purity, e.g., >95%.

32 . A method of treating a cancer in a subject, the method comprising administering an effective amount of the antigen-binding construct of any of claims 1 through 27 to the subject.

33 . The method of claim 32 , wherein the subject is a human.

34 . The method of claim 32 , wherein the cancer is a lymphoma or leukemia or a B cell malignancy, or a cancer that expresses CD19, or non-Hodgkin's lymphoma (NHL) or mantle cell lymphoma (MCL) or ac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) or ch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L) or rituximab- or CHOP (Cytoxan™/Adriamycin™vincristine/prednisone therapy)-resistant B cell cancers.
